HandiText Sign Language Recognition
Project focuses on translation of sign language gestures into Text or Audio, allowing other people who does not understand sign language to communicate with specially abled people
Project objective is to allow seamless conversation and remove the communication barrier that exists between the normal and speciall abled, who are unable to speak or listen. This Project will help these kinds of people to possibly lead a normal life
Project is implemented on Python. Machine learning with Image recognition is being used to recognize hand signs and gestures. These are then later converted into audio or text
Benefits of Projects are that instead of using a translator to translate sign gestures into sentences, application can be used to interpret those signs
CNN algorithm is being used. Along with it, keras and tensorflow libraries are being more. Further more, a gpu based system is used for faster training of model. Dataset is collected from internet. For advanced gestures, dataset is being collected which is not available on internet
